Jean Smart has received two Emmy awards for her role as Deborah Vance on the HBO comedy Hacks.

She also portrayed “D.A. Roseanna Remmick” in Harry’s Law on which she starred alongside Kathy Bates, Nathan Corddry, and Christopher McDonald. She is widely recognized for her roles as “Charlene Frazier Stillfield” on the CBS sitcom Designing Women and “Martha Logan” on 24. Plus, her work as "Regina Newly" on Samantha Who? garnered Smart a Primetime Emmy Award. Smart also earned two Emmys for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Comedy Series for Frasier on which she played the role of “Lana Gardner.” The actress has appeared in numerous films and television shows including The District, Center of the Universe, Kim Possible, $#*! My Dad Says, Garden State, Sweet Home Alabama and Hawaii Five-O. She also notably portrayed "Her Royal Highness Camilla" in the 2011 TV movie William & Catherine: A Royal Romance.
